NOTICE TO CONSIGNEES. Consignees are rainded of the necessity to apply to the Company's Agents regarding arrival of consignments exported of which they have received documents *or ad view.

Ang damaged packages must be left in the Godowas for examination by the Consignees and the Company's Surveyors, Messy Goddard and Douglas, at 10 am. on Mondays and Thursdays. All claims must be presented within ten days of the steamer's arrival hen, after which date they cannot be recognised. No Claims will boudmitted after the goods have left the Godowns.
